“When you sprinkle a little water for 20 minutes, the roots stay at the surface,” she explains. “The plants suppose, ‘I higher stay on the top of the soil and anticipate water! ’” Instead, she trains the plant roots to grow deep into the soil the place it is cool and moist by soaking crops totally however sometimes. She waters perennials frequently until they're established, however after that they solely get water throughout a extreme dry spell. The plant choices aren’t the one place they provide a nod to the countryside. RJ Roberts, Lorraine’s husband, makes rustic furnishings out of the twisted stems of the dead black cherry trees discovered around the property. They chose cedar for swan chairs, arbors, and break up rail fences, because the pure look of the wood is more consistent with the environment than painted or man-made supplies can be.

Although perennials go dormant in winter, the snow-covered gardens usually are not without attraction. Roberts crops winter-interest shrubs as a foundation planting round her house and as a backdrop between the perennials and the trees.
“When surrounded by this many bushes, it’s so stunning with simply the snow,” she says. “In rural and nation gardens, snow is a blessing as a end result of it acts as a protective mulch.” Dragon arums and Agapanthus are two crops which aren’t normally hardy in that zone, however survive within the Roberts backyard. The timber and snow cover shelter plants from the freeze/ thaw cycle which may be so damaging to tender species. She additionally credits her use of compost and mycorrhizal fungi with allowing her to take this tack.
